Pea Ridge

North Carolina Red Blend

The Parker-Binns Vineyard Pea Ridge is a delightful red blend hailing from the picturesque North Carolina region. This wine presents a vibrant red color that captivates the eye. On the palate, it boasts a medium-bodied structure, providing a well-rounded mouthfeel that enhances its overall appeal. Acidity is refreshing, adding a lively brightness that dances with each sip. The fruit intensity is prominent, showcasing a harmonious blend of dark berries and cherries, perfectly complemented by subtle hints of spice and earthiness. Tannins are soft and well-integrated, contributing to a smooth and approachable finish. The wine is crafted to be dry, making it an excellent companion for a variety of dishes. This blend captures the essence of North Carolina's terroir, resulting in an expressive and enjoyable experience for any wine enthusiast.

Region:


North Carolina

North Carolina, with its picturesque landscapes ranging from the Atlantic coastline to the Appalachian Mountains, is a diverse and rapidly growing winegrowing region in the southeastern United States. The state's American Viticultural Areas (AVAs) are shaped by varying climates and elevations, which significantly influence the character of the vineyards. The cooling breezes from the Atlantic Ocean and the elevation provided by the mountains help to moderate the climate, allowing for a longer growing season. This extended season is crucial for the slow, even ripening of grapes, enabling them to develop full flavors while maintaining balance. Vineyards in the cooler mountain areas excel in producing aromatic, delicate wines, while the warmer coastal and inland areas are ideal for fuller, more robust varieties.
